摘要
Theoretical and experimental studies have been performed on the effect of the gas-discharge plasma on the vacuum are droplet fraction arriving at the sample in plasma-assisted deposition of TiN coatings. It has been shown that the number of droplets on a negatively biased sample decreases four or five times if the droplet flow passes through the plasma of a low-pressure non-self-sustained are discharge having a higher electron temperature than the plasma of the vacuum are. Possible mechanisms for the observed plasma filtration of the droplet fraction of a vacuum are are discussed.
